Danbing
Danbing is a Taiwanese egg crepe rolled around scallions and sauce, with a chewy wrapper, soft egg layer, and crisp edges that make it a fast savory breakfast-for-dinner.

Whisk flour, tapioca starch, water, and salt into a thin batter and let it hydrate.
Cook a ladle of batter in an oiled skillet until the edges turn translucent.
Pour beaten egg and scallions over the crepe, then flip so the egg sets against the pan.
Brush with soy paste and sesame oil, then roll the danbing tightly.
Slice into pieces and serve with chili crisp on the side.
